Chairman steps down at Michael Hintze’s CQS

The chairman of Sir Michael Hintze’s $12 billion hedge fund CQS has stepped down from his role after just under five years.

Marc Hotimsky has left to pursue interests outside of finance, according to a person familiar with the matter.
